The day after, Keiman went to adventurer guild as usual.
Entering through the door, Keiman went straight to the bulletin board.
A board where quests were posted at.
There were many quests here.
From gathering herbs to subjugating monsters.
For today, Keiman wanted to be a supporter.
Someone who brought the luggage while the other party members were fighting.
A luggage carrier in short.
After searching through the paper pinned on the board, Keiman finally found what he wanted.
A supporter for a party that was going to subjugate a group of orcs.
Orc was a low-level monster.
The same as goblin and kobold.
A rank D adventurer could defeat an orc if they fought each others.
Orc had the head of a pig and a big body of at least 2 meters.
Only one orc was insignificant, but if it was a huge horde of orcs, that was a different thing.
There had been a kingdom that was destroyed by a horde of orc under the Orc Lord.
That horde was finally subjugated after 3 kingdom allied and sending their armies and high ranking adventurer.
But for this quest, it was only for subjugating a group of only five orcs.
A D rank party was enough to defeat them.
Keiman brought the paper to the receptionist.
"A supporter, I see. Please wait for a moment."
The receptionist lady was writing something on a thick book.
After a while.
"It's done. The party is waiting on the west gate, you can go there."
"Thank you."
*****
The west gate of Jahne Town.
A group of five people was standing there.
A man with giant sword on his back.
A man with a big shield and also a sword on his waist.
A man wearing a robe and a cone hat.
Advertisement
A woman wearing a priest robe and holding a cane.
A woman with tight clothes and short daggers on her waist.
A perfect balance for a party.
Looking at the badge on their shoulders, there was four stars there.
That means that they were rank D.
A badge was used by every adventurer.
From it, someone could see what rank someone was.
Rank E had five stars and the amount of stars decreased every rank up.
Rank A had one star.
For rank S, they had a special badge with the image of moon.
There were also rank SS but there were only five peoples in the world.
Their badge had the image of sun.
Keiman approached the party.
"Ah, you finally came."
The man with the shield waved his hands at Keiman.
It looked like he was the leader of the party.
A supporter was easy to notice because of their big backpack on their back.
To become a supporter, one only need a big backpack.
"Please treat me well."
Keiman bowed to the five peoples.
"Yes, yes of course. Then let's go."
A five person party and a supporter went on to the west of Jahne Town.
Kuriya forest to be exact.
The forest where the orcs were first sighted.
The six peoples kept moving forward, without knowing what awaited them.
